Définitions
1.NounThe characteristic of using a minimum of something (especially money)."His thrift can be seen in how little the trashman takes from his house."
2.NounA savings bank."Usually, home mortgages are obtained from thrifts."
3.NounAny of various plants of the genus Armeria, particularly Armeria maritima.
4.NounSuccess and advance in the acquisition of property; increase of worldly goods; gain; prosperity; profit.
5.NounVigorous growth, as of a plant.
6.VerbTo shop or browse at a thrift shop; to buy (something) at a thrift shop."They like to go thrifting on weekends.; I thrifted these vintage coffee mugs."
